What happens in Chapter 11.
Obi continues to struggle with money. His salary never stretches far enough, and the demands from his family and the Umuofia Progressive Union keep tightening the squeeze. Clara's pregnancy becomes known to Obi, and the situation forces a confrontation he has been avoiding. He wants to marry her but cannot figure out how to tell his parents she is an osu. The chapter shows Obi caught between two worlds, unable to satisfy either one.
The beats worth remembering.
Clara reveals she is pregnant
Clara tells Obi she is expecting his child. This raises the stakes immediately because now the osu problem is not just a social question but a practical crisis that needs a decision fast.
Obi's financial accounts laid bare
The chapter makes Obi's money situation concrete. His salary, his loan repayments, his mother's medical costs, and the union contributions add up to more than he earns. There is no slack anywhere.
Obi considers telling his parents about Clara
Obi thinks through how his parents would react to Clara's osu status. He keeps putting off the conversation, which shows that his modern education has not actually given him a way to handle traditional pressure.
The moments you can actually use later.
Obi's monthly budget breakdown
Achebe walks the reader through Obi's income and outgoings in near-accounting detail, showing that even without any emergencies he is already in deficit. Students can use this scene to argue that Obi's later corruption has economic roots.
Obi's internal rehearsal of the conversation with his parents
Obi mentally scripts how he might tell his parents about Clara and then abandons the script each time. This pattern of rehearsal without action is a reliable piece of evidence for arguments about his indecisiveness.
What to carry forward.
Financial pressure is a trap, not just background noise
Obi's debt is specific and structural. Students should track how each new expense closes off another option. This matters later when bribery starts looking like the only exit.
The osu problem is now urgent, not theoretical
With Clara pregnant, Obi can no longer treat her caste status as something to deal with eventually. The delay itself becomes a character flaw worth noting in essays.
